Titan Mining Corporation (NYSEAMERICAN:TII – Get Free Report) was the recipient of some unusual options trading on Thursday. Stock traders bought 5,066 call options on the company. This is an increase of approximately 1,985% compared to the average volume of 243 call options.

Titan Mining Stock Performance
NYSEAMERICAN TII opened at $2.10 on Friday. Titan Mining has a 12 month low of $1.25 and a 12 month high of $5.65. The business has a 50-day moving average of $2.22. The company has a current ratio of 0.68, a quick ratio of 0.48 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.73.
Titan Mining (NYSEAMERICAN:TII –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, May 12th. The company reported ($0.14) earnings per share for the quarter. The company had revenue of $19.60 million for the quarter. Titan Mining had a negative net margin of 17.67% and a negative return on equity of 332.15%.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Titan Mining will post -0.12 earnings per share for the current year.
Titan Mining Company Profile
Titan Mining Corporation, a natural resource company, acquires, explores, develops, produces, and extracts mineral properties. The company explores for zinc and graphite, as well as iron-oxide copper gold deposits. Its principal asset is the Empire State Mine project covering an area of approximately 80,000 acres located in the Balmat– Edwards mining district in northern New York. The company was formerly known as Triton Mining Corporation and changed its name to Titan Mining Corporation in November 2016.
